uni-app 4.36编译微信小程序skyline存在BUG
uni-app 4.36编译微信小程序skyline存在BUG
操作步骤:
1
预期结果:
能成功编译
实际结果:
无法编译:devtools was disconnected from the page once page is reloaded devtools will automatically reconnect
bug描述:
配置skyline渲染模式,运行到微信模拟器,无限报错:devtools was disconnected from the page once page is reloaded devtools will automatically reconnect
4.29没问题
项目信息 | 版本/方式 |
---|---|
产品分类 | uniapp/小程序/微信 |
PC开发环境操作系统 | Windows |
PC开发环境操作系统版本号 | Win11 24H2 |
HBuilderX类型 | 正式 |
HBuilderX版本号 | 4.36 |
第三方开发者工具版本号 | Nightly Build 1.06.2411212 |
基础库版本号 | 3.6.6 |
项目创建方式 | HBuilderX |
感谢反馈,提供个复现工程我看看
@DCloud_UNI_OttoJi 复现工程及截图
针对您提到的uni-app 4.36编译微信小程序skyline存在BUG的问题,由于我无法直接访问具体的BUG描述或重现步骤,我将提供一个基础的uni-app编译微信小程序并处理常见编译错误的示例代码和流程。这可以帮助您检查是否是基础配置或代码问题导致的编译失败,或者为进一步的调试提供参考。
1. 确保环境配置正确
首先,确保您的开发环境已经正确安装并配置了uni-app和微信开发者工具。
# 安装HBuilderX(推荐的开发工具)
# 从官网下载安装包并安装
# 确保uni-app CLI已安装(可选,如果使用命令行编译)
npm install -g @dcloudio/uni-cli
2. 创建一个简单的uni-app项目
# 使用HBuilderX创建新项目,或者使用命令行
vue create -p dcloudio/uni-preset-vue my-uni-app
cd my-uni-app
3. 配置manifest.json
在manifest.json
中配置微信小程序的相关信息,如appid等。
{
"mp-weixin": {
"appid": "your-app-id",
"setting": {
"urlCheck": false
}
}
}
4. 编写页面代码
在pages/index/index.vue
中编写简单页面代码。
<template>
<view>
<text>Hello, Uni-app!</text>
</view>
</template>
<script>
export default {
data() {
return {}
}
}
</script>
<style>
/* 添加一些简单样式 */
view {
display: flex;
justify-content: center;
align-items: center;
height: 100vh;
}
</style>
5. 编译并运行
在HBuilderX中,点击“发行”->“小程序-微信”,或者使用命令行:
# 使用uni-app CLI编译
npm run dev:mp-weixin
编译完成后,打开微信开发者工具,导入生成的dist/build/mp-weixin
目录,查看是否有编译错误或警告。
6. 调试与错误处理
如果编译失败,检查以下几点:
- 微信开发者工具的版本是否与uni-app兼容。
manifest.json
和pages.json
中的配置是否正确。- 代码中是否有语法错误或不被微信小程序支持的API调用。
如果以上步骤无法解决问题,建议查看uni-app的官方文档或社区论坛,查找是否有其他开发者遇到并解决了类似的问题。